Greeley-Weld Habitat for Humanity helps individuals and families achieve strength, stability, and self-reliance through shelter. Habitat homeowners pay an affordable mortgage, save a modest down payment, contribute 300 hours of “sweat-equity” building their homes and meet the income guidelines. The vision is a world where everyone has a decent place to live. Greeley-Weld Habitat for Humanity is part of a global, nonprofit housing organization. Greeley-Weld Habitat for Humanity is dedicated to eliminating substandard housing locally and worldwide through constructing, rehabilitating, and preserving homes; by advocating for fair and just housing policies; and by providing training and access to resources to help families improve their shelter conditions. Greeley-Weld Habitat for Humanity has built 200 homes in Weld County since 1987.
